ATLAS is a growing defense contractor, so you'll likely gain experience across diverse healthcare settings. Here are some things you'll probably do: Provide comprehensive medical services within the scope and level of a Nurse Practitioner/Physician Assistant in various clinical settings. Systematically assess urgent or emergent health needs, analyze clinical data, and formulate effective care plans in collaboration with other medical team members. Recognize and treat illnesses and injuries according to established protocols within your scope of licensure and state regulations. Maintain accurate and thorough patient documentation in accordance with standard protocols and Privacy Act requirements. Identify and record signs and symptoms of physical and mental conditions with precision and clinical insight. Exercise independent judgment, problem-solving skills, and clinical decision-making in prioritizing patient care needs. Participate in professional development and continuing education to remain current with healthcare practices and emergency medical treatment trends. Monitor and reconcile financial transactions to ensure uniform application of contract charges. Protect patient privacy through confidentiality practices, infection control procedures, consistent medication administration, and proper equipment maintenance. Deploy to various locations as needed, providing critical medical support where required. Qualifications

Graduation from an accredited Nurse Practitioner/Physician Assistant program with current NCCPA, AANP, or ANCC Certification. Active and unrestricted NP/PA License without pending adverse actions and ability to be favorably credentialed per Acuity policy. Minimum of 3 years of recent experience as a Nurse Practitioner/Physician Assistant. Current Basic Life Support and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support certifications. Willingness to obtain Advanced Trauma Life Support (ATLS) certification before deployment. Recent clinical experience with at least 6 months of direct patient care within the past year.
